dobre praktyki
Jak wygląda proces testowy? Część 1
0
Proces testowy - to jest to o czym chciałabym dzisiaj Wam opowiedzieć. W poprzednich artykułach opisywałam niektóre elementy tego procesu. Teraz postaram się dodać...
Dev:Cast – #10 Dobrych Praktyk Tworzenia Oprogramowania
Sieć pełna jest porad dotyczących dobrych praktyk tworzenia oprogramowania. Możemy czytać o SOLID, DRY, KISS, Demeter, GRASP czy STUPID. Pytanie czy to jednak wszystko?...
Dev:Cast – #09 Coding Dojo. Sposób na aktywną wymianę wiedzy
O Coding Dojo pisałem całkiem niedawno, w odniesieniu do działającej na śląsku inicjatywie. Tym razem jednak udało mi się porozmawiać z organizatorami Coding Dojo...
Egoless Programming – Mniej ego podczas programowania
W 1971 roku można było śledzić losy dwóch misji księżycowych wykonanych przez statek Apollo 14 oraz Apollo 15. Gdy amerykanie latali w kosmos, w...
Coding Dojo Silesia
Aby być w czymś mistrzem, należy ćwiczyć. Ciągle i systematycznie, rozwijając swoją samodyscyplinę oraz doskonalić swoje rzemiosło.
Ćwiczenia możemy wykonywać samemu, często nie wiedząc, że...
Czasami warto pisać brzydki kod
Pewnie wielokrotnie spotkaliście się z artykułami albo książkami, które mówią Wam, że:
kod musi być piękny,
design nie powinien być kruchy,
powinno się używać wzorców...
Dev:Cast – #04 Wartość Code Review
Czy automatyzując analizę kodu do maksimum, ciągle potrzebujemy przeprowadzać Code Review? Czy czynnik ludzki będzie jeszcze wtedy potrzebny? Czy nie jest to moment kiedy...
Dev:Cast – #02 Dlaczego boimy się popełniać błędy
Nadeszła pora aby przedstawić drugi odcinek podcastu Dev:Cast. Tym razem dyskutujemy o temacie Tomasza, który brzmiał: "dlaczego developerzy boją się odbijania notek". Rozmawialiśmy o...
97 rzeczy które każdy programista powinien wiedzieć. Część piąta (65-80)
To już przedostatni post z cyklu streszczeń artykułów pt. 97 rzeczy które każdy programista powinien wiedzieć, jak zawsze zachęcam do przejrzenia oryginału.
65. Zamiast używać...
Blog, Hype i Fake News
Dzisiejszy post nie dotyka bezpośrednio aspektów technicznych, a stanowi bardziej zapis moich przemyśleń na temat odpowiedzialności za informacje w Internecie, zarówno za te, które...